Meet Laine Wiesemann ("wise woman" she quips!) a California native, incredible SF artist, and co-founder of 415 ZINE (https://www.415zine.com/) a quarterly publication that she and her colleague Alfredo Sainz -- a fellow SF artist -- founded back in 2023. They've been friends for years, having regular tea and coffee meetings to discuss artistic endeavors and goals. During an outing in the Haight Alfredo busted out paper samples and said, "let's make an art zine." Laine was shocked. "I had an idea for an art magazine just this week!" The name and concept quickly came together. Serendipitous collaboration and enthusiasm has resulted in a fresh zine that aims to promote local artists, and connect people to art, artists & art establishments in San Francisco. The publication is named after the location's area code, 415, a number well known by any native or local. Here's Laine sharing her story with Haight Street Voice Radio, December 2025. Enjoy!
